Biopsychosocial model of health
The biopsychosocial health model, which is an integrated approach to health care acknowledges the importance of the psychological, social, and biological elements in the development of illness and diseases. An individual's genetic predisposition for depression could be triggered by factors such as social and psychological aspects. The ability to cope with emotions could contribute to the development of an individual health issue.
The biopsychosocial method recognizes that there are a variety of methods to treat or prevent health issues. It examines the psychological, social and biological aspects that impact health. As a result, it can provide better treatment and management of health problems. However, it is not without its drawbacks. Some argue that it's impossible to treat some health conditions just based on their physiologic levels.
The biopsychosocial model is becoming more and more popular in research on health. It is possible to cross-disciplinaryly analyze it, even with its flaws. It also applies to complex interactions between biological, psychological and social factors. The complicated interactions among various factors was described in a summary of research on physical activity behavior.
The biopsychosocial approach is similar to a socio-ecological approach. The major difference between the two models is the fact that the biopsychosocial model emphasizes the interdisciplinarity of the method and its ability to examine multiple factors simultaneously.
Health determinants that are social in nature
The social and environmental environment can have a major influence on health. These factors can influence health outcomes , and could cause health inequities. Addressing these factors can help people lead healthier lives. There are numerous ways to enhance the quality of life. This includes reducing exposure to harmful substances as well as creating safe areas for recreation and exercise.
One of the most effective ways to improve wellbeing and health in communities with low income is to make sure that children have access to the educational opportunities they require. Children who don't have access to quality education or a good facility for childcare may experience issues with their development or behavior. These issues may eventually lead to chronic illnesses later in life. There are, however, several evidence-based methods to reduce the harmful effects of poverty.
More health care delivery networks are taking into account non-medical, social factors that affect health. Health plans of the federal and state levels now focus on the social determinants of health. Additionally, health providers can also address the social needs of patients that go beyond medical.
The amount of income you earn is a major social element that influences health. Studies have shown that higher incomes are associated with better health. In reality, high-income countries have a higher life expectancy on average than lower-income countries. The health outcomes are strongly related to education and income. A good early education is essential to social development. A high-quality high school education is crucial to higher education and job opportunities.
Cultural influences on our health
Cultural differences can be a significant factor in the way that health outcomes are determined. Food exercise, diet, and social structures of a particular culture might differ from those in other different cultures. A doctor can customize their treatment to accommodate the differences using an approach that is culturally sensitive to patient care. This method can boost satisfaction of patients and aid in the diagnosis and treatment compliance.
Today's society is becoming more multi-cultural, and the cultural differences may impact health treatment. This is something that all those who study multiculturalism should consider when delivering their health healthcare. For example, the complexity of health care delivery based on cultural norms demand an understanding of how to interact with clients from different cultures.
The cultural context also influences the decisions of both patients and health care healthcare providers. The way that people seek medical care is influenced by the health and cultural aspects including gender roles, religion, or religious beliefs. These cultural differences could affect the outcome of treatment as well as the patient's education. Understanding the differences between cultures can ease the process both for the patient and the healthcare provider.
Other than cultural factors the socioeconomic status of a person's language can influence health-related choices as well. The influence of cultural diversity on health has been well-documented in research studies. Studies have demonstrated that cultural influences affect the health literacy of people, their access to healthcare, and health literacy.
Wellness programs at work
Health care cost increases are a significant issue for employees and companies today and wellness programs for workplaces are one way to combat this trend. Through a range of media they educate employees on the benefits of a healthy lifestyle. They may include print and video materials, quizzes about health and bulletin boards. Participants can be offered incentives by their employers.
Workplace wellness programs should be flexible enough to meet the needs of employees with disabilities. Some programs offer child care and transportation and others provide nutritional classes or assistance in getting healthy food choices. Worker should not be punished for not meeting the goals they set. But, the programs must be designed to ensure the wellbeing of employees.
The previous studies of workplace wellness programs have shown positive returns, measured in terms of the reduction or absence from health healthcare. These results have some limitations because of selection bias and the weaknesses of the methodological approach. Studies based on controlled experiments that are randomised are more likely to yield reliable results.
The EEOC is the agency of the government responsible for enforcing the ADA and GINA and GINA, has recently proposed guidelines on workplace wellness programs for employees. The regulations were drafted to protect workers against discrimination and to encourage employers to offer healthier options to employees.
